jeds market has a total of 26 employees. Each full time employee makes $275/ week, and each part-time employee makes $140/ week.
I am Lyosha [343]

Answer:

f=17\\p=9\\

Step-by-step explanation:

Let

f= Full-time\\p=Part-time

Full time rates-$275, Part-time rates-$140

The problem can be expressed as:

f+p=26...eqtn1\\275f+140p=5935....eqtn2\\

Express eqtn1 in terms of f,f=26-p

Substitute f value in eqtn 2.

=>275(26-p)+140p=5935\\7150-275p+140p=5935\\1215=135p\\p=9\\f=26-9=17\\

Therefore,  jeds has 17 fulltime and 9 parttime employees.
